Java中的多线程编程实例

原创 亦凉 2025-03-11 12:51 12阅读 0赞

在Java中,多线程编程主要是通过Thread类来实现的。以下是一个简单的多线程示例:

  1. // 创建一个新线程
  2. public class MultiThreadExample {
  3. public static void main(String[] args) {
  4. // 创建一个要在线程中运行的任务
  5. Runnable task = new Task("Hello, World!");
  6. // 创建并启动新的线程来执行任务
  7. Thread thread = new Thread(task);
  8. thread.start();
  9. }
  10. }
  11. // 任务类,用于在线程中运行
  12. class Task implements Runnable {
  13. private String message;
  14. public Task(String message) {
  15. this.message = message;
  16. }
  17. @Override
  18. public void run() {
  19. System.out.println(message);
  20. }
  21. }

在这个例子中,我们创建了一个新的线程来执行Task类中的任务。这样就实现了多线程编程。

文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。

发表评论

表情:
评论列表 (有 0 条评论,12人围观)

还没有评论,来说两句吧...

相关阅读